fini Posted February 1, 2003 Share Posted February 1, 2003 I've checked into the Elite warranty ( I called Pioneer), and they do not cover Elite products purchased over the internet. In other words, there are no "authorized" online retailers. In order to get the (Elite standard) 2-year warranty, you must buy from a brick-and-mortar store. The online retailer may offer their OWN, or a third-party warranty, but it's not from Pioneer. fini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
